                                               Bonifacio-Corse-du-Sud-Corse
Bonifacio, in the Corse-du-Sud departement.
In fact if you go more south you will find Sardinia, since Bonifacio is the "southernest" city in metropolitan France.
The citadel built on these cliffs is a famous landscape.

                                                                Balos beach
The most famous landscape of Crete and it is definitely worth it. All the shades of blue and green, a warm, shallow lagoon bursting with sea shells. It is accessible after a half hour march, or you can take the boat departing from Kasteli Kisamou


Mount Jolmo Lungma Everest
Mount Jolmo Lungma is covered with huge glaciers that descend from the main peak and its nearby satellite peaks. The mountain itself is a pyramid-shaped horn, sculpted by the erosive power of the glacial ice into three massive faces and three major ridges, which soar to the summit from the north, south, and west and separate the glaciers.

The moonlike landscape of Mungo National Park
Mungo National Park is a part of the Willandra Lakes World Heritage Area, a chain of dried-out lakes that were once strung between Willandra Creek and the main channel of the Lachlan River in Outback NSW.
